Overall, the experience was awful. Would definitely not hire again. Contracted for the removal of existing counters and installation of new granite counters. After two attempts, they delivered a cracked piece of granite for the sink area that they had apparently glue back together. When I pointed this out, they said it was a fissure. I had three experts analyze the cracks and all agreed that it was, indeed cracked. I had also reserved an additional piece of granite from the wholesalers so that the counter could be replaced.

I made several attempts to resolve the issue with Cava, but, at this point, I have had to engaged legal counsel.

The first time they were to install the counter, they delivered the incorrect edge profile, so everything had to go back to the shop to be re-cut. During the installation of the counter the second time, they severely damaged several areas of the new drywall wall and chipped part of the brick chimney out and broke several lower cabinet sides and rails and also destroyed two of the under counter lights. They refused to repair these.

Because of their negligence, the completion of the kitchen project had to be put on hold until the necessary installation of new counter and repairs can be made..

Where do I start. They do have a nice showroom. The people seemed nice at first. It was my experience that they do not pay attention to details and there are serious communication gaps between their salespeople and the shop room. I brought a drawing to them for a marble window sill. They make a mistake copying it to their drawing format.. They say that will make a new sill for me. After I leave they make a new drawing for the sill and completely mess up the other measurements that they got correct the first time. I have to take it back again. It took them three times to get a simple window sill cut correctly. Of course they didn't try to help me out by fixing my error a little more quickly. No call backs when they said they would. The line you will hear is "can we call you right back". Don't expect that call. After three weeks of this nightmare I eventually had to call my credit card company to dispute the charges. Buyer beware.
